About Dr. James Glenn, MD

Dr. Glenn graduated from University of Florida College of Medicine in 1987 and completed a residency at Med College Of Ga Hospital and Cli. Dr. James Glenn, MD is an Orthopedic Surgeon in Green Bay, WI and has 39 years experience. Dr. Glenn has experience treating conditions like Joint Pain among other conditions at varying frequencies. Dr. Glenn's office accepts new patients. Dr. Glenn is board certified in Orthopedic Surgery and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
